71932 ACDGB/P4A Bearing Product Overview & Core Advantages
The 71932 ACDGB/P4A is a single-row angular contact ball bearing engineered for high-precision applications requiring exceptional rotational accuracy and rigidity. Designed to accommodate primarily axial loads in one direction, combined with moderate radial loads, this bearing features a 25° contact angle and P4A super-precision tolerance class, making it ideal for machine tool spindles and other high-speed, high-accuracy machinery. Its universal matching (SU) capability allows for flexible mounting arrangements in sets to handle complex load conditions.
71932 ACDGB/P4A Bearing Model Code Explained, Specifications & Naming Convention
| Code Segment | Technical Meaning |
|---|---|
| 71932 | Basic bearing series and size designation (160mm bore, 220mm OD) |
| AC | Angular Contact design with 25° contact angle |
| D | High ball complement design for increased load capacity |
| GB | Light preload / Class B for reduced deflection and vibration |
| P4A | Super precision tolerance class for exceptional running accuracy |
71932 ACDGB/P4A Bearing Structural Features & Performance Benefits
High-Precision Construction: Manufactured to P4A tolerance class with bore and outside diameter tolerances of -0.004mm to 0, ensuring minimal runout and superior rotational accuracy for precision applications.
Optimized Load Capacity: Features a 25° contact angle and high ball complement (28 balls of 19.05mm diameter) providing excellent axial load capacity (34,425 lbf static) while maintaining good radial load handling (27,900 lbf dynamic).
High-Speed Capability: The phenolic resin cage ensures stable operation at high speeds with a limiting speed of 11,000 rpm, while the light preload (Class B) minimizes friction and heat generation.
Universal Matching Design: As a Universal Matchable (SU) bearing, it can be arranged in sets of three to accommodate combined loads and moments, providing design flexibility for complex applications.
Premium Material Selection: Constructed from chrome steel for both rings and balls, offering excellent wear resistance and durability across a wide temperature range (-30°C to 110°C).
71932 ACDGB/P4A Bearing Typical Application Areas
- Machine Tool Spindles: High-precision machining centers, grinding spindles, and milling machines
- Precision Instrumentation: Measuring equipment, optical instruments, and laboratory apparatus
- High-Speed Rotating Machinery: Turbines, compressors, and pumps requiring precision operation
- Robotics and Automation: Industrial robot arms, CNC machinery, and precision positioning systems
- Aerospace Components: Guidance systems, aircraft instrumentation, and satellite mechanisms
